Kava-Kava Regulations, 2004. Country/Territory Malta Document type Regulation Date 2004 Source FAO, FAOLEX Subject Food & nutrition Keyword Food quality control/food safety Internal trade International trade Geographical area Europe, Europe and Central Asia, European Union Countries, Mediterranean, Southern Europe Abstract On the basis of the powers conferred by article 10 of the Food Safety Act of 2002, the Minister of Health has made the present Regulations, which prohibit the manufacture, sale and importation into Malta of any food which contains or consists of Kava-Kava (i.e. a plant, or any part of, or an extract from, a plant belonging to the species Piper methysticum).
